I Have the A*300 f4. It's a nice lens but the minimum focusing distance is 
just under 4 meters - a little too far for some uses (nothing like stalking 
close to a subject - only to realize you are too close...)  300mm is not a 
focal length I use a lot, and when I do I usually use a zoom.  If you plan 
to use the lens a lot the F or FA would probably be a better choice.
